    Cryopyrin-Associated Periodic Syndrome: An Update on Diagnosis and Treatment Response

    Cryopyrin-associated periodic syndrome (CAPS) is a rare hereditary inflammatory disorder encompassing a continuum of three phenotypes: familial cold autoinflammatory syndrome, Muckle-Wells syndrome, and neonatal-onset multisystem inflammatory disease. Distinguishing features include cutaneous, neurological, ophthalmologic, and rheumatologic manifestations. CAPS results from a gain-of-function mutation of the NLRP3 gene coding for cryopyrin, which forms intracellular protein complexes known as inflammasomes. Defects of the inflammasomes lead to overproduction of interleukin-1, resulting in inflammatory symptoms seen in CAPS. Diagnosis is often delayed and requires a thorough review of clinical symptoms. Remarkable advances in our understanding of the genetics and the molecular pathway that is responsible for the clinical phenotype of CAPS has led to the development of effective treatments. It also has become clear that the NLRP3 inflammasome plays a critical role in innate immune defense and therefore has wider implications for other inflammatory disease states

    Is the meiofauna a good indicator for climate change and anthropogenic impacts?

    Our planet is changing, and one of the most pressing challenges facing the scientific community revolves around understanding how ecological communities respond to global changes. From coastal to deep-sea ecosystems, ecologists are exploring new areas of research to find model organisms that help predict the future of life on our planet. Among the different categories of organisms, meiofauna offer several advantages for the study of marine benthic ecosystems. This paper reviews the advances in the study of meiofauna with regard to climate change and anthropogenic impacts. Four taxonomic groups are valuable for predicting global changes: foraminifers (especially calcareous forms), nematodes, copepods and ostracods. Environmental variables are fundamental in the interpretation of meiofaunal patterns and multistressor experiments are more informative than single stressor ones, revealing complex ecological and biological interactions. Global change has a general negative effect on meiofauna, with important consequences on benthic food webs. However, some meiofaunal species can be favoured by the extreme conditions induced by global change, as they can exhibit remarkable physiological adaptations. This review highlights the need to incorporate studies on taxonomy, genetics and function of meiofaunal taxa into global change impact research

    Denial of racism and its implications for local action

    Literature on modern racism identifies denial as one of its key features. This article examines the discourses of denial that feature in the talk of local anti-racism actors in Australia, and asks what drives these discourses. The research draws on qualitative interviews undertaken with participants involved in local anti-racism in two case study areas, one in South Australia and the other in New South Wales. This article explores the way local participants in the case study areas deployed four discourses to deny or minimise racism: temporal deflections; spatial deflections; deflections from the mainstream; and absence discourses. Place defending and the desire to protect one's local area from being branded a racist space is discussed as a driver of those local denial discourses. Local denial of racism is also linked to national politics of racism and anti-racism. In particular, the Australian government's retreat from multiculturalism, and the preference for 'harmony' rather than 'anti-racism' initiatives, was linked to the avoidance of the language of racism within participants' responses. The way denial discourses narrow the range of possibilities for local anti-racism is discussed, as is the importance of acknowledgement of racism, particularly institutional and systemic racism. Public acknowledgement of these forms of racism will broaden the scope of local anti-racism. © The Author(s) 2013
